C’N’C is a young, urban brand with a real digital culture.
In 2008, the brand presented an advertising campaign dedicated to the Myspace generation, with casting via social networks. C’N’C has also embodied its modernity with muses such as Lizzy Jagger, Jethro Cave, Abraham Belaga and Pixie Geldof.
For this Spring Summer 2012 season, the brand continues to explore the web generation through a universe where images are used, adopted, distorted, destructured, reblogged, accumulated, reinterpreted…
An overexploitation of images with the Tumblr platform as the keystone.
Tumblr is a “microblogging” platform that allows members to post texts, images, links, quotes or audio sequences that other members can “reblog”.
Tumblr is the compulsive reign of the image, one of the platforms where major visual trends emerge: analog photography, animated gifs, color classifications, food photography, the cult of bad taste…to name but a few. In this world of absolute freedom, a new type of corrupted image is emerging, heralding the beginnings of an aesthetic of digital chaos. –
This new C’N’C campaign is inspired by this fascinating visual experience through its press campaign, Tumblr and videos. This season’s face is the young actress Jeanne Damas, the new lolita adored by photographers and fashion magazines, whose fame was born in the heart of the blogosphere.
